This is a race I am working on for my Daiyun Campaign. All comments and critque are welcome. :tiphat:

Gildantine look like half-elves, but are just as varied as humans. They were a race created by a diety named Laudia to combat evil planar creatures (demons, specifically, but others are just as well.) They have every hair and skin shade a human has, but they are genrally average to slim, have pointy ears, and have blue, green, brown, hazel, lavendar, silver, or gold eyes. They tends twards any non-evil alignment, but they live on a variety of planes.

Most live on the Material plane, Celesta, Elysum (sp?), Arborea, and some even willingly live in the Abyss or the Nine Hells, usually for undercover work.

Gildantine Traits:

- +2 Charisma, +2 Intelligence, -2 Strength
(Think Half-orc traits reversed.) Gildantine are charming, cunning, and knowledgeable, but are physically weak.

-Outsider (Native) Type. Immune to Charm Person or Humanoid affecting spells. Gildantine mostly live on other planes, but many also live on the Material planes. Some say they started out on the Material Plane, which explains their Native Subtype. (They can be brought back from the dead.)

- +2 on Sense Motive, Bluff, and Hide checks. Gildantine are adept investigators. They have to be to hunt evil outsiders.

- +4 dodge bonous against fiends.

- +2 on Knowledge (The Planes)

- +1 on attack rolls against outsiders with the evil subtype.

- + 1 on Listen and Spot checks. Gildantine have keen ears and eyes.

- -2 on Intimadate checks. Because they are not physically strong, they don't seem as threatning to others. They are actually friendly people, and try to avoid up front confrontation due to thier lack of strength.

- Disrupt Evil (su): This spell-like ability functions as the Disrupt undead spell in the PHB, but it damages any outsider with the evil subtype, OR a creature with an evil alignment in general. This ability is usable once per day, and deals 1d8 damage or +1d8 if used to add power to another attack.

Automatic Languages: Common and Celestial

Others: Draconic, Abyssal, Infernal, Elven, Sylvan

Gildantine are often in contact with extraordinary races.

Favored Class: Ranger. Rouge, Bard, Cleric, Sorcerer, and Wizard are also good choices. But, Gildantine Bards are rare.

Level Adjustment: +0 or +1 (Help!) :confused:

There is an overall gain in ability modifiers, but the other things don't look good enough to make it LA +1 I think. Dwarves still have much more.

Hmmm...Thanks. I thought it would be balaned becaused Half-Orcs have the opposite (+2 Str, -2 INT and CHA), so I thought reversing it wouldn't change the balance. (Acording to the DMG, th reason for the two penalties was to balance the str bonus, so, if they had a str penalty, and didn't get a constitution or dexterity bonus, having a bonus to charisma and inteligence would balance it- I almost considered a wisdom bonus, but I thought they would be to much like aasimar, so I chose intelligence instead).
